The only real constructive points i can make are, the percussion loop could do with some more variation maybe some edits at the end of 16 bars ect, your reverse type edit sounds a little unnatural the way it drops to scilence first maybe you could try the reverse then the scilence, and the only other small point is you appear to have stopped the rendering short and lost the end of the reverb tail.
